                            By: Phillips (Senate Sponsor - Creighton) H.B. No. 2501
 (In the Senate - Received from the House May 3, 2017;
 May 4, 2017, read first time and referred to Committee on Business &
 Commerce; May 15, 2017, reported favorably by the following vote:
 Yeas 9, Nays 0; May 15, 2017, sent to printer.)
Click here to see the committee vote


 A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
 AN ACT
 relating to insurance requirements for certain nonemergency
 medical transportation.
 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
 SECTION 1.  Section 1954.001(4), Insurance Code, is amended
 to read as follows:
 (4)  "Transportation network company" means a
 corporation, partnership, sole proprietorship, or other entity
 operating in this state that uses a digital network to connect a
 transportation network company rider to a transportation network
 company driver for a prearranged ride.  [The term does not include
 an entity arranging nonemergency medical transportation under a
 contract with the state or a managed care organization for
 individuals qualifying for Medicaid or Medicare.]
 SECTION 2.  Section 1954.002, Insurance Code, is amended to
 read as follows:
 Sec. 1954.002.  APPLICABILITY OF CHAPTER.  (a) This chapter
 applies to automobile insurance policies in this state, including
 policies issued by a Lloyd's plan, a reciprocal or interinsurance
 exchange, and a county mutual insurance company.
 (b)  This chapter does not apply to an entity arranging
 nonemergency medical transportation services under a contract with
 the state or a managed care organization for individuals qualifying
 for Medicaid or Medicare unless the entity:
 (1)  provides the transportation services through a
 digital network that connects transportation network company
 drivers to transportation network company riders for prearranged
 rides;
 (2)  contracts individually with each transportation
 network company driver who is connected to transportation network
 company riders for the prearranged rides through the entity's
 digital network; and
 (3)  otherwise meets all requirements under the
 Medicaid or Medicare program for delivery of nonemergency medical
 transportation services.
 SECTION 3.  This Act takes effect September 1, 2017.
